[Adopted 5-4-1992 by Ord. No. 9-92]
The proposed intergovernmental cooperation agreement between the Township of Colebrookdale, Berks County, Pennsylvania, party of the first part, and the Borough of Boyertown, Berks County, Pennsylvania, party of the second part, which would give to the Borough complete governmental control of the Borough park, which is situate on lands in Colebrookdale Township by the Borough, is hereby approved in the form attached hereto as Exhibit A.[1]
[1]
Editor's Note: Exhibit A is on file in the Borough offices.
The proposed intergovernmental cooperation agreement which is attached hereto as Exhibit A is made a part hereof by reference.
The President of the Borough Council and the Borough Secretary are hereby authorized and directed to execute said intergovernmental cooperation agreement on behalf of the Borough, upon adoption of an appropriate ordinance by the Board of Supervisors of the Township of Colebrookdale.
